Python training in Kochi EMIGO helps you to get an extensive knowledge of Python programming language. Python training by EMIGO is an instructor-led training conducted in Kochi premises.
Python language is a popular language, it stands out to be one of the premier courses for EMIGO. Our consultants are high-skilled with Python programming and they ensure that training conducted is more practical oriented and at the end of the course participants will be still able to develop projects individually. EMIGO ensures the best python training experience during the course of your training program. Python designed by us is unique which helps you start learning Python from basics to advanced Python concepts. Which makes us to Best Python Training center in Kochi.
According to the TIOBE index, Python is one of the most popular programming languages in the world
What is Python?
Python is an Object oriented, high level and multipurpose language. Python is very easy to learn and can be interpreted to more number of Operating Systems including UNIX based systems. Python makes debugging easily because there are no compilation steps in Python development and edit-test-debug cycle is very fast.
The power of Python
The power of Python is exploited in the development of popular web applications like YouTube, Dropbox & Bit Torrent. No wonder that even NASA has used it in space shuttle mission design & in discovery of ‘Higgs-boson’ particles (GOD particles). The rich set of modules available in the language made the top security agency NSA use Python for cryptography. Not to mention that giants like Disney, Sony DreamWorks have used it in game & movie development. Nowadays, given the data is becoming “BIG”, programmers resort to Python for web scraping/Sentiment analysis. Think of ‘Big Data’, the first technology that comes to a programmer’s mind in processing that (ETL & data mining) is Python.
PYTHON COURSE CONTENT
SECTION 1: INTRODUCTION
SECTION 2: USING THE INTERPRETER
SECTION 3: TYPES AND OPERATORS
SECTION 4: BASIC STATEMENTS
SECTION 5: FUNCTIONS
SECTION 6: MODULES
SECTION 7: CLASSES
SECTION 8: EXCEPTIONS
SECTION 9: BUILT-IN TOOLS OVERVIEW
SECTION 10: SYSTEM INTERFACES
SECTION 11: GUI PROGRAMMING
SECTION 12: DATABASES AND PERSISTENCE
SECTION 13: TEXT PROCESSING
SECTION 14: INTERNET SCRIPTING
SECTION 15: ADVANCED TOPICS
WEB APPLICATION DEVELOPMENT WITH DJANGO FRAMEWORK
SECTION 1: INTRODUCTION TO DJANGO FRAMEWORK
SECTION 2: GETTING STARTED WITH DJANGO FRAMEWORK
SECTION 3: URL PATTERNS AND VIEWS
SECTION 4: DJANGO FORMS
SECTION 5: COOKIES, SESSION AND FILE UPLOADING
Impressed with our Course Content?
Attend a Free Demo Session to Experience our Quality!
The Python Developer Proudly say that the following Most Popular Websites using Python Language.
History of Python
BBC’s ‘Monty Python’, a comedy series, released during the late 1960s was a huge hit. The Python programming language, released in early 1990’s, eponymous of the comedy series, turned to be a huge hit too, in the software fraternity. Reasons for the hit-run into a long list – be it the dynamic typing, or cross-platform portability, enforced readability of code, or its ability to take the shape of a scripting or a programming language or a faster development turnaround.
Learning Python is quite a fun
Thanks to its interactive console, even a person who is getting his feet wet with programming can quickly learn the concepts. Possessing the features of both the scripting language like TCL, Perl, Scheme & a systems programming language like C++, C, Java, Python is easy to run & code. Show a Java program and a Python script to a novice programmer – he definitely finds Python code more readable. The Python script is first converted to platform-independent bytecode making Python a cross-platform one. You don’t need to compile & run unlike C, C++ thus making the life of software developer easier.
OOP in Python
The OOP features such as inheritance, polymorphism and encapsulation support reusability as well. However, OOP is an option in Python. You can still write a simple script to calculate the complex Dijkstra’s algorithm for mathematical computation without using OOP. But, if you check the PyPI (Python Package Index) list of available modules, even the Djikstra’s algorithm is available as a module you can plug & play. Such is the comprehensiveness of the modules index.
Databases in Python
Python can interact with all databases including SQL databases such as Sybase, Oracle, MySQL and NoSQL databases such as MongoDB, CouchDB. In fact, the ‘dictionary’ data structure that Python supports is the ideal one for interacting with NoSQL database such as MongoDB which processes documents as a key-value pair. Web frameworks written in Python such as Flask, Django facilitates faster web application building & deployment. It is also employed to process unstructured data or ‘BIG DATA’ & business analytics. Notable to mention are Web scraping/Sentiment analysis, data science, text mining. It is also used with R language in statistical modelling given the nice visualization libraries it supports, such as Seaborn, Bokeh and Pygal. If you’re used to working with Excel, learn how to get the most out of Python’s higher level data structures to enable super-efficient data manipulation and analysis.
Importance of Python
Companies of all sizes and in all areas — from the biggest investment banks to the smallest social/mobile web app startups — are using Python to run their business and manage their data, especially because of its OSI-approved open source license and the fact that it can be used for free. Python is not an option anymore but rather a de facto standard for programmers & data scientists.